Step-by-Step Guide: How to Hang up Shorts

1. Sort your shorts: Begin by sorting your shorts by type, such as denim, casual, or dressy. This will help you decide the best hanging method for each pair.

2. Choose appropriate hangers: Select hangers suitable for shorts, such as pant or skirt hangers. These hangers typically come with clips or clamps to hold the shorts securely.

3. Fold the shorts: Fold each pair of shorts in half lengthwise, aligning the seams and ensuring they are free of wrinkles.

4. Attach the hangers: Open the hanger clips or clamps and slide them onto the folded shorts, making sure they are securely fastened.

5. Hang the shorts: Place the hanger with the shorts on a clothing rod or rack. Ensure that the shorts are hanging vertically, without any twists or tangles.

Common Questions and Answers:

1. Should I hang all types of shorts?

While most types of shorts can be hung, delicate or lightweight fabrics like silk or linen may be better suited to folding or storing in a drawer.

2. Can I hang shorts made of denim?

Yes, denim shorts can easily be hung using pant or skirt hangers. Ensure that the hanger is sturdy enough to support the weight of the denim.
